HORSE RACING: Jockey Dominguez begins rehab from fractured skull

Jockey Ramon Dominguez has been transferred to a rehabilitation center as he recovers from a skull fracture suffered in a spill at Aqueduct last month.

His wife Sharon issued a statement saying Dominguez was transferred on Wednesday from the New York Presbyterian/Weill Cornell Medical Center in Manhattan to the Burke Rehabilitation Hospital in White Plains, N.Y.

“Although his injury will take time to heal, Ramon is on the road to a full recovery,” she said.

There is no timetable for his release from Burke.

Dominguez, injured on Jan. 18, has won the last three Eclipse Awards as the nation’s leading rider.
